Output 5ddf31f12b10d85c33a251da445261dd5a575f60ab34403004ee0d13df67ebd8:0

value
6009928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b57f9d167bc1f7a00c2d2a924a574d9dbef51e OP_EQUAL
address
MFzD83hypAZKxwWWWKGdzg2aUMSfvJLzua
transaction
5ddf31f12b10d85c33a251da445261dd5a575f60ab34403004ee0d13df67ebd8
spent
true